Definition

colpitis

(kŏl-pī'tĭs )

(kŏl-pīt'ĭs)

Vaginitis (2).

c. macularis Small red spots on the epithelium of the upper vagina and cervix. The spots are seen best with a colposcope and are called, colloquially, “strawberry spots.” They are often seen in women who are infected with trichomonas.
